@ -250,3 +250,38 @@ func moveFile(src types.Path, dst types.Path) error {
}
return nil
}
// moveFileWithHashCheck attempts to move the file src to dst and checks for hash collisions based on metadata
// Check if destination file exists. As the destination is based on a hash of the file data,
// if it exists and the content length does not match then there is a hash collision for two different files. If
// it exists and the content length matches, it is believable that it is the same file and we can just
// discard the temporary file.
func moveFileWithHashCheck(tmpDir types.Path, mediaMetadata *types.MediaMetadata, absBasePath types.Path, logger *log.Entry) (string, bool, error) {
duplicate := false
finalPath, err := getPathFromMediaMetadata(mediaMetadata, absBasePath)
if err != nil {
removeDir(tmpDir, logger)
return "", duplicate, fmt.Errorf("failed to get file path from metadata: %q", err)
}
var stat os.FileInfo
if stat, err = os.Stat(finalPath); os.IsExist(err) {
duplicate = true
if stat.Size() == int64(mediaMetadata.ContentLength) {
removeDir(tmpDir, logger)
return finalPath, duplicate, nil
}
// Remove the tmpDir as we anyway cannot cache the file on disk due to the hash collision
removeDir(tmpDir, logger)
return "", duplicate, fmt.Errorf("downloaded file with hash collision but different file size (%v)", finalPath)
}
err = moveFile(
types.Path(path.Join(string(tmpDir), "content")),
types.Path(finalPath),
)
if err != nil {
removeDir(tmpDir, logger)
return "", duplicate, fmt.Errorf("failed to move file to final destination (%v): %q", finalPath, err)
}
return finalPath, duplicate, nil
}
